Hi, Are you sure they're just not asking for your AppleID passcode?
After one powers off the phone and reactivates the device, entering your passcode is required, the touch ID is not yet active on the phone. After the above, the first time one goes back to the AppStore to purchase an app, one must enter the Apple passcode associated with your AppleID. I'm not sure if this also applies to the circumstance you described, where after unlocking the phone and a passcode is asked for, that this step would also be necessary. I can't tell from your message below if you are getting a second request for a code, or just the one. At any rate, I hope you get this fixed.
